Key Agencies Managing Public Records in Georgia
In Georgia, public records are maintained by a variety of state and local government agencies. These records include court documents, property information, criminal history, and more. Below are some of the key authorities that manage public records in Georgia:
- Georgia Bureau of Investigation: Provides access to criminal records and background checks.
- Georgia Department of Public Health: Maintains vital records such as birth, death, marriage, and divorce certificates.
- Georgia Department of Corrections: Offers offender search tools and correctional facility information.
- Georgia Secretary of State: Manages business registrations, corporate filings, and records related to government transparency.
- Georgia Courts: Provides access to court records and case information.
These agencies play a vital role in ensuring the accuracy and accessibility of public records, serving as trusted resources for individuals and professionals who need verified information. Which government agencies maintain public records in Georgia?
Public records in Georgia are maintained by several government agencies,
including the Georgia Department of Public Health, the Georgia Superior
Court Clerks' Cooperative Authority, local county clerks, and other
state departments.

Is it legal to look up public records in Georgia?
Yes, accessing public records in Georgia is legal under the Georgia Open
Records Act. However, the information should be used responsibly and in
compliance with privacy laws.
